Naduwa Population - Siwan, Bihar
Naduwa is a medium size village located in Bhagwanpur Hat Block of Siwan district, Bihar with total 120 families residing. The Naduwa village has population of 773 of which 396 are males while 377 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Naduwa village population of children with age 0-6 is 122 which makes up 15.78 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Naduwa village is 952 which is higher than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Naduwa as per census is 877, lower than Bihar average of 935.
Naduwa village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Naduwa village was 75.12 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Naduwa Male literacy stands at 85.80 % while female literacy rate was 64.06 %.

Naduwa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 120 | - | - |
Population | 773 | 396 | 377 |
Child (0-6) | 122 | 65 | 57 |
Schedule Caste | 101 | 50 | 51 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 75.12 % | 85.80 % | 64.06 % |
Total Workers | 180 | 171 | 9 |
Main Worker | 85 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 95 | 92 | 3 |
